TCM 4432 01F — Construction Administration
CRN 83323
3.0 credit hours
Terms, documents and operations inherent in building construction management. Topics include business ownership, company organization, project bidding/negotiating methods, construction contracts, bonds, insurance and accounting. Prerequisite(s): A minimum grade of "C" in TCM 3331 or CENG 3135 and Junior status.
